Pic of the Week: Hielan’ Coo by Brian McCormick
THIS was an image I took while on a trip to Mull in the spring.
I found a herd of cows in a field and, after watching this cow for a few minutes, I crept slowly closer to it and picked a moment to take the photo — just after it ate some grass.
I loved the image as soon as I took it due to the warm lighting and being able to see all the detail in the hairs around the nose and tongue.
